Creatine, according to the Cleveland Clinic, is a natural source of energy in the body that aids in muscle contractions. It's created in the kidneys, pancreas and liver and stored in the body's skeletal muscle, then metabolized during physical activity. Video of the Day

Poultry: Chicken and turkey are also excellent sources of natural creatine. A four ounce serving of chicken contains about 450 mg of creatine. Fish: Fish, especially herring, salmon, and tuna, are rich in natural creatine. For example, a four ounce serving of herring can provide up to 950 mg of creatine.

ENERGY Creatine increases phosphocreatine stores. Phosphocreatine helps create adenosine triphosphate (ATP), which drives many processes in our cells. ATP is the main source of energy for most of our cellular functions. It's stored in our muscle cells and used within the first few seconds of intense exercise.

The following foods are rich in creatine: Herring - 3 to 4.5 grams of creatine per pound of herring. Pork - 2.25 grams of creatine per pound of pork. Beef - 2 grams of creatine per pound of beef.
